Title :
Gauge control in tandem cold rolling mills: a multivariable case study using ℋ∞ optimization
Author :
Postlethwaite, Ian ; Geddes, John
Author_Institution :
Dept. of Eng., Leicester Univ., UK
Abstract :
This paper considers the application of robust multivariable control, based on ℋ∞ optimization, to the problem of gauge control in a tandem cold rolling mill. The work has been undertaken as part of a collaborative research project between CEGELEC Projects Ltd., Rugby, and the University of Leicester
